Summary

The Twilio developer contest is an ongoing initiative that challenges developers to create unique and powerful submissions using Twilio voice and/or SMS for alerts and notifications. The contest aims to encourage developers from all backgrounds to try Twilio for different use cases, industries, and integrations. Submissions are due by midnight on Sunday, May 30th, and can be submitted through a designated link. Bonus points will be awarded for creating helpful materials such as screencasts and blog posts that demonstrate the value of the submission or explain how it could become a business someday. Previous non-winners are eligible to resubmit their projects with improved features, and resources such as documentation, ebooks, industry reports, webinars, and community forums are available to help developers improve their skills and knowledge.
